Caring for Your Diecast
Proper care is essential for preserving the value and condition of your Acura TL Type S diecast models. The primary steps in caring for your models include storing them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Direct sunlight can cause paint to fade, damaging the value of your models. Cleaning the models regularly using a soft cloth to remove dust and debris is another important aspect. Handling the models with care and avoiding touching the paint finish helps prevent scratches. Displaying your models in a protective case can protect them from dust and accidental damage. These simple measures help ensure that your diecast models remain in excellent condition for years to come.
